Frequently Asked Questions
How are movers in South Wheatland rated?
The professional moving companies in South Wheatland are scored according to four key metrics: Transparency, Pricing, Services Offered, and Overall Reputation. For local movers on which there is limited data, pricing is replaced by accessibility and distance. So if a mover is close to your location, then they will be awarded a higher score. For large moving companies, scores are compiled manually and through exhaustive use-testing. Local movers are scored according to their presence online, website content, reviews, accreditation, services, and distance. All of these data are compiled from publicly available sources by leveraging advanced data models and programs.
Is it cheaper to hire a moving company in South Wheatland?
The cost of hiring a moving company has a lot to do with how many items you are moving, how far it is, and the quality of your movers. From a purely monetary standpoint, hiring movers will always cost more, but it is also important that you consider how you value the stress, time, and significant effort of moving. For example, you may want to consider temperature, traffic, heavy lifting, or the opportunity cost of missing work and important events. In general, we always recommend hiring a mover IF it’s within your budget.

What items should I move myself?
When moving long distances, accidents can happen and boxes could get misplaced, stolen, or damaged. We recommend moving certain important items yourself. This includes – firearms, cash, financial documents, health data, jewelry, artwork and anything potentially dangerous if it were to leak like pesticides, gasoline, etc.
